https://github.com/datalad/datalad-osf

DataLad extension to interface with the Open Science Framework

https://github.com/datalad/datalad-osf

Science Score: 33.0%

This score indicates how likely this project is to be science-related based on various indicators:

  • CITATION.cff file
  • codemeta.json file
    Found codemeta.json file
  • .zenodo.json file
  • DOI references
  • Academic publication links
    Links to: zenodo.org
  • Committers with academic emails
    2 of 16 committers (12.5%) from academic institutions
  • Institutional organization owner
  • JOSS paper metadata
  • Scientific vocabulary similarity
    Low similarity (15.8%) to scientific vocabulary

Keywords

closember datalad

Keywords from Contributors

neuroimaging bids neuroscience data-standards git-annex rdm fmri neuroimaging-data brain-imaging brain-connectivity
Last synced: 5 months ago · JSON representation

Repository

DataLad extension to interface with the Open Science Framework

Basic Info
  • Host: GitHub
  • Owner: datalad
  • License: other
  • Language: Python
  • Default Branch: main
  • Homepage:
  • Size: 1.46 MB
Statistics
  • Stars: 15
  • Watchers: 7
  • Forks: 12
  • Open Issues: 14
  • Releases: 0
Topics
closember datalad
Created over 5 years ago · Last pushed over 1 year ago
Metadata Files
Readme Changelog Contributing License Code of conduct

README.md

DataLad-OSF: Opening up the Open Science Framework for DataLad

All Contributors <!-- ALL-CONTRIBUTORS-BADGE:END -->

GitHub release PyPI version fury.io Build status codecov.io docs Documentation Status DOI

Welcome! This repository contains a DataLad extension that enables DataLad to work with the Open Science Framework (OSF). Use it to share, retrieve and collaborate on DataLad datasets via the OSF.

The development of this tool started at OHBM Brainhack 2020 in June 2020, coordinated in this repository. See our documentation for more extensive information.

Requirements

Installation

```

create and enter a new virtual environment (optional)

$ virtualenv --python=python3 ~/env/dl-osf $ . ~/env/dl-osf/bin/activate

install from PyPi

$ pip install datalad-osf ```

Afterwards, configure DataLad to load the datalad-next extension:

git config --global --add datalad.extensions.load next

How to use

See our documentation for more info on how to use this tool and a tutorial on major use cases.

How to contribute

You are very welcome to help out developing this tool further. You can contribute by:

  • Creating an issue for bugs or tips for further development
  • Making a pull request for any changes suggested by yourself
  • Testing out the software and communicating your feedback to us

Please see our contributing guidelines for more information.

Contributors ✨

Thanks goes to these wonderful people (emoji key): <!-- ALL-CONTRIBUTORS-LIST:START - Do not remove or modify this section --> <!-- prettier-ignore-start --> <!-- markdownlint-disable -->

Michael Hanke
Michael Hanke

🚧 💻 🐛 🤔
Dorien Huijser
Dorien Huijser

📖 📆 🤔 📓
Ashish Sahoo
Ashish Sahoo

📖 🚧
Simon Steinkamp
Simon Steinkamp

⚠️ 📖 📆 🤔 📓 🚧
Benjamin Poldrack
Benjamin Poldrack

📆 🤔 💻 🚧
Nick
Nick

📆 🤔 💻 🚧
Nikita Beliy
Nikita Beliy

🤔 📓
Moritz J. Boos
Moritz J. Boos

💻 📓 🤔 🚧
Adina Wagner
Adina Wagner

📆 🤔 💻 📖 🚧
Stefan Appelhoff
Stefan Appelhoff

📖 📓
Tom Hu
Tom Hu

🚇
Danny Garside
Danny Garside

🐛

This project follows the all-contributors specification. Contributions of any kind welcome!

Acknowledgements

This DataLad extension was developed with support from the German Federal Ministry of Education and Research (BMBF 01GQ1905), and the US National Science Foundation (NSF 1912266).

GitHub Events

Total
  • Watch event: 1
  • Issue comment event: 3
Last Year
  • Watch event: 1
  • Issue comment event: 3

Committers

Last synced: about 2 years ago

All Time
  • Total Commits: 318
  • Total Committers: 16
  • Avg Commits per committer: 19.875
  • Development Distribution Score (DDS): 0.623
Past Year
  • Commits: 28
  • Committers: 4
  • Avg Commits per committer: 7.0
  • Development Distribution Score (DDS): 0.321
Top Committers
Name Email Commits
Michael Hanke m****e@g****m 120
Adina Wagner a****r@t****e 54
allcontributors[bot] 4****] 34
Dorien Huijser d****r@o****m 31
Benjamin Poldrack b****k@g****m 30
Stefan Appelhoff s****f@m****g 9
mjboos m****s@u****e 9
Dorien Huijser 5****r 8
Nick Guenther n****e@u****a 8
SRSteinkamp s****p@g****m 5
Ashish Sahoo 6****6 5
Ashish Sahoo a****6@g****m 1
Simon Steinkamp S****p 1
Yaroslav Halchenko d****n@o****m 1
Tom Hu t****m@c****o 1
Danny Garside d****e@o****m 1
Committer Domains (Top 20 + Academic)

Issues and Pull Requests

Last synced: over 1 year ago

All Time
  • Total issues: 70
  • Total pull requests: 68
  • Average time to close issues: 5 months
  • Average time to close pull requests: about 1 month
  • Total issue authors: 21
  • Total pull request authors: 13
  • Average comments per issue: 2.64
  • Average comments per pull request: 2.37
  • Merged pull requests: 57
  • Bot issues: 0
  • Bot pull requests: 3
Past Year
  • Issues: 13
  • Pull requests: 8
  • Average time to close issues: 20 days
  • Average time to close pull requests: about 1 month
  • Issue authors: 7
  • Pull request authors: 4
  • Average comments per issue: 3.54
  • Average comments per pull request: 0.88
  • Merged pull requests: 8
  • Bot issues: 0
  • Bot pull requests: 1
Top Authors
Issue Authors
  • mih (25)
  • adswa (13)
  • yarikoptic (7)
  • hvgazula (5)
  • da5nsy (3)
  • bpoldrack (2)
  • asmacdo (2)
  • sappelhoff (2)
  • stebo85 (1)
  • sebastientourbier (1)
  • mikapfl (1)
  • OleBialas (1)
  • mjboos (1)
  • joeyzhou98 (1)
  • oesteban (1)
Pull Request Authors
  • mih (29)
  • adswa (17)
  • bpoldrack (6)
  • DorienHuijser (4)
  • allcontributors[bot] (3)
  • mjboos (2)
  • sappelhoff (2)
  • yarikoptic (2)
  • SRSteinkamp (2)
  • thomasrockhu-codecov (1)
  • TheDragon246 (1)
  • da5nsy (1)
  • kousu (1)
Top Labels
Issue Labels
bug (21) enhancement (11)
Pull Request Labels

Packages

  • Total packages: 1
  • Total downloads:
    • pypi 2,477 last-month
  • Total docker downloads: 9,685
  • Total dependent packages: 3
  • Total dependent repositories: 4
  • Total versions: 8
  • Total maintainers: 2
pypi.org: datalad-osf

DataLad extension to interface with the Open Science Framework (OSF)

  • Versions: 8
  • Dependent Packages: 3
  • Dependent Repositories: 4
  • Downloads: 2,477 Last month
  • Docker Downloads: 9,685
Rankings
Docker downloads count: 1.7%
Downloads: 6.1%
Dependent packages count: 7.3%
Dependent repos count: 7.6%
Average: 8.1%
Forks count: 10.2%
Stargazers count: 15.6%
Maintainers (2)
Last synced: 6 months ago